Turin, May 30 (LaPresse) – Germany will decide whether to approve new arms supplies to Israel based on an assessment of the humanitarian situation in Gaza. This was stated by Foreign Minister Johann Wadephul in an interview with the newspaper Sueddeutsche Zeitung, as reported by The Guardian. Wadephul questioned whether what is happening in Gaza complies with international law. "We are examining the situation and, if necessary, will authorize further arms shipments based on this assessment," he explained. The minister also stated that Israel must be able to defend itself, including with German weapon systems.
